GPR Led mod question.

I was told by another member on FTE to do the GPR led light mod and after looking into it I figured for the small amount of money for the led and the free wire and fuse holder from work why not its a great mod. My only question is, Ive only seen one led but I looked under the hood the other day and there are two relays. Should I install one for the one bank and another to another bank??

And I have looked under the dash to find a spot to feed wiring out into the engine comartment but couldnt find a hole or anything. Maybe I didnt look hard enough??

What size fuse is everyone using? I know leds arent using really anything but just looking for a general fuse size?

The relay to the rear of the two is the glow plug relay. See pic. That's the one to tap your wire to. If you look at your parking brake pedal under the dash, you should see a bundle of wire with a silver tag on them saying "customer access." Those wires pass through the firewall into the engine compartment right up by the master cylinder. Use one of those wires to pass through for your LED. I used a 2amp fuse.

When you 'delete' the AIH, do you just unplug the element?

I saw the adapter on riff raff's page, but no instructions on what you do with the AIH element itself. I presume removing it won't throw a code, right?

Pull the element, remove the red lead wire from the relay to the element, and remove the ground wire (or unhook from the element and let it hang in the engine valley) and you are done. It will throw a soft code but set off the SES light.
